A Budget-Friendly Home Decor Refresh
Want to give your space a fresh new look without breaking the budget? It’s totally doable! You don't need a major renovation to create a stylish atmosphere. Start by shifting your existing furniture – sometimes a simple swap of pieces in several rooms can make a huge change. Then, consider adding some budget-friendly accents like updated throw pillows, some cozy blanket, or the strategically placed vase. Thrifting and secondhand shops are treasure troves for unique finds. Don't underestimate the power of some fresh coat of hue – even just one accent wall can add serious vibrancy to a area. Finally, decluttering is free and always a positive way to create a more open and more attractive setting.
